7:30PM – John Dalton's Spheres of Influence
John Dalton is a Boston Area based drummer, composer, improviser, and bandleader. He has performed in a variety of settings. He has been involved in groups that have featured at the New Bedford Jazz Festival, the Medford Jazz Festival, and the New Bedford Roots and Branches Festival. he has performed at venues such as Fete Music hall, Dowtown music Gallery, the Zeiterion Theater, Boston University, Wally’s Cafe Jazz Club, iBeam, and Cafe 939 at Berklee College of Music. He has performed or shared the bill with artists such as Tony Malaby, Jim Robitaille, Phillip Greenlief, Dino Govoni, Amanda Monaco, John Sullivan, Barry Altschul, Dennis Montgomery, Jerome Harris, Stefano Battaglia, Kaya Meller, Kamil Piotrowicz, Anastassiya Petrova, and royal hartigan.. John has also received grants from the Massachusetts Cultural Council, Medford Arts Council, and the Somerville Arts Council for work with his modular ensemble Spheres of Influence, which performs original compositions, standards, as well as arrangements of well known repertoire.

Sequoyah Cisneros is a Boston-based saxophonist, improviser, and composer. Sequoyah was raised in Palisade, Colorado, and, since moving to Boston to study at Berklee College of Music, has performed with John Patittucci, Brian Blade, Danilo Perez, Francisco Mela, Ingrid Jensen, Gilberto Santa Rosa, and Ledisi, among others. Additionally, he has had the privilege of studying with Tony Malaby, Billy Kilson, George Garzone, Matthew Stevens, and Godwin Louis. Since graduating from Berklee in 2025, Sequoyah has performed frequently as a sideman as well as with his band, Smokejumper, with whom he presents original compositions and improvisations.

Sam Childs is a tenor and soprano saxophonist, specializing in Jazz and improvised music. Sam plays often in the Boston jazz scene, at venues such as, the Lilypad, the Monkfish, and as well as larger venues such as Symphony Hall, Wang Theatre, and Chevallier Theatre. Sam got his education at New England Conservatory, and has studied with Billy Hart, Cecil McBee, Dave Holland, Jerry Bergonzi, Nasheet Waits, Anthony Coleman, and Frank Carlberg. Sam has played with Tony Malaby, Francisco Mela, Charles Downs, Joe Morris, Alex Minasian, as well as the Temptations, and the Four Tops. Sam’s projects focus primarily on group improvisations, as heard on his most recent album Sam Childs and Evan Palmer (2026), and a live quartet recording Breathe (2025).

Born 1971 and raised in Seattle, bassist Nate McBride has spent most of his musical life in Boston and Chicago. A bandleader, sideman, writer and improviser, McBride has performed widely on upright and electric bass with groups and musicians across a wide range of scenes: the East Coast scene, the Chi scene, the Euro Impro scene, and the local scenes wherever he’s lived. Moving comfortably between improvised and written music, jazz and noise rock, McBride has found durable, decades-spanning connections with musicians like Pandelis Karayorgis, Joe Morris, Curt Newton, Ken Vandermark, Jeff Parker, Jeb Bishop, Dave Rempis, Jason Adasiewicz, Mike Reed, and many others.

The Fully Celebrated Orchestra has been a force on the Boston music scene since saxophonist/composer Jim Hobbs and bassist Timo Shanko started playing free jazz at punk rock clubs and street corners in the late 1980s. Still going strong as underground legends over three decades later, FCO also features cornetist Taylor Ho Bynum, drummer Luther Gray, and guitarist Ian Ayers.
Jim Hobbs was born and raised in north-eastern Indiana at the convergence of three rivers. He is a recipient of the Doris Duke New Works Grant for composition from Chamber Music America. After a childhood of chewing hay and catching salamanders he began playing the saxophone. He received a full scholarship to Berklee College of Music where he majored in composition. It was there that he met bassist Timo Shanko and started the Fully Celebrated Orchestra (FCO), which has released 10+ recordings on various labels including Silkheart, Skycap and Innova. FCO is also the subject of a children's book.
He has performed and recorded with Joe Morris, Luther Gray, Taylor Ho Bynum, Bill Lowe, The Jazz Composers Alliance, Forbes Graham, The Prodigal Suns, Mackie Burnett, Fred Hopkins, Laurence Cook, Jon Voight, Junko Simons, Nightstick, The Death's Head Quartet, Josh Roseman, Curtis Hasselbring, The Lunch Factor, Laura Andel, Brother Blue and many others.
